Loading...

Ce este gestionarea erorilor în Laravel?

Laravel facilitează afișarea paginilor de eroare personalizate pentru diferite coduri de stare HTTP. De exemplu, dacă doriți să personalizați pagina de eroare pentru codurile de stare HTTP 404, creați un șablon de vizualizare resources/views/errors/404.blade.php. Această vizualizare va fi redată pentru toate cele 404 erori generate de aplicația dvs. Ce este gestionarea erorilor în Laravel? Tratarea erorilor se referă la anticiparea, detectarea și rezolvarea erorilor de programare, aplicații și comunicații. Pentru unele aplicații sunt disponibile programe specializate, numite manipulatori de erori.

Ce se înțelege prin tratarea erorilor?

Gestionarea erorilor se referă la rutinele dintr-un program care răspund la intrări sau condiții anormale. Calitatea unor astfel de rutine se bazează pe claritatea mesajelor de eroare și pe opțiunile oferite utilizatorilor pentru rezolvarea problemei.

Pentru ce este folosit gestionarea erorilor?

În schimb, gestionarea erorilor ajută la menținerea fluxului normal de execuție a programelor software.

Ce este tratarea erorilor și tipurile acesteia?

Gestionarea erorilor se referă la procedurile de răspuns și de recuperare din condițiile de eroare prezente într-o aplicație software. Cu alte cuvinte, este procesul compus din anticiparea, detectarea și rezolvarea erorilor aplicației, erorilor de programare sau erorilor de comunicare.

Cum gestionați gestionarea erorilor?

Gestionarea erorilor folosind Do-Catch. Folosiți o instrucțiune do – catch pentru a gestiona erorileprin rularea unui bloc de cod. Dacă o eroare este aruncată de codul din clauza do, aceasta este comparată cu clauzele catch pentru a determina care dintre ele poate gestiona eroarea.

Ce este tratarea erorilor în DBMS?

Excepțiile sunt metoda de tratare a erorilor care apar în timpul execuției programelor. Aceste erori sunt rezultatul valorilor datelor care apar ca urmare a execuției programului. Dezvoltatorul nu va ști anterior unde și când poate apărea eroarea. Dar va avea o idee despre unde ar putea apărea eroarea.

Ce este testarea excepțiilor?

Testarea excepțiilor este o caracteristică specială introdusă în JUnit4. În acest tutorial, ați învățat cum să testați excepția în JUnit folosind @test(excepted) Junit oferă facilitatea de a urmări excepția și, de asemenea, de a verifica dacă codul aruncă excepție sau nu.

Ce se înțelege prin recuperarea erorilor?

Recuperarea erorilor este capacitatea compilatorului de a relua analizarea unui program după detectarea unor astfel de erori în timpul procesului de compilare. Analizorul obține un șir de jetoane de la analizatorul lexical și verifică și apoi revine dacă este detectată vreo eroare de sintaxă.

Ce este conectarea în Laravel?

Înregistrarea Laravel se bazează pe „canale”. Fiecare canal reprezintă un mod specific de scriere a informațiilor din jurnal. De exemplu, canalul unic scrie fișiere jurnal într-un singur fișier jurnal, în timp ce canalul slack trimite jurnalmesaje către Slack. Mesajele de jurnal pot fi scrise pe mai multe canale în funcție de gravitatea acestora.

Cum gestionează Laravel erorile și excepțiile?

Pentru orice proiect nou, Laravel înregistrează erorile și excepțiile din clasa App\Exceptions\Handler, în mod implicit. Acestea sunt apoi trimise înapoi utilizatorului pentru analiză. Când aplicația dvs. Laravel este setată în modul de depanare, mesajele de eroare detaliate cu urme de stivă vor fi afișate pentru fiecare eroare care apare în aplicația dvs. web.

Cum să înregistrați mesajele de eroare în Laravel folosind PHP?

Laravel folosește biblioteca de jurnal PHP monolog. Parametrii de înregistrare utilizați pentru urmărirea erorilor sunt unic, zilnic, syslog și errorlog. De exemplu, dacă doriți să înregistrați mesajele de eroare din fișierele jurnal, ar trebui să setați valoarea jurnalului din configurația aplicației la zilnic, așa cum se arată în comanda de mai jos –

La ce folosește cererea de acțiune în Laravel?

Atunci când utilizatorul face ca fișierul principal și primul start.php să efectueze o acțiune (necesară) asupra celui din urmă sau al doilea fișier start.php, se constată că managerul aplicației poate beneficia, deoarece utilizatorul poate lucra cu ușurință la orice îmbunătățiri viitoare. poate avea loc în cadrul Laravel.

Putem suprascrie șabloanele de coduri de stare în Laravel?

Puteți suprascrie oricare dintre șabloanele de cod de stare laravel. Una dintre principalele caracteristici ale Laravel pentru gestionarea erorilor este gestionarea excepțiilor. Laravel vine cu un dispozitiv încorporathandler de excepții care vă permite să raportați și să creați excepții într-un mod ușor și prietenos.

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*